I have a very small client with three lines and a fax. I have line 4 set as the fax line; it is extension 34 on the phone system. If I plug a regular phone into extension 34, the line rings on that ext and no others, but if I plug the fax machine in it won't pick up and the call just rings forever; I can see it blinking on the other Partner phones which have a line appearance but no ring (I would like to keep it in the system so it is available for outbound calls.)

I went into programming and told the system it was a fax extension, and still no ringing. I have done this a lot in the past and every now and then this occurs. Any suggestions what causes it and if it can be fixed so the fax line can run through the system? I temporarily bypassed it until I had a chance to post this question here. Thanks!
 
I've seen some fax machines that simply won't answer to the ringing signal from a Partner control unit. They don't like the voltage and/or the waveform.

First just call the extension on the Intercom from another extension, and see if it picks up. You can also try setting #308 to Not Active.

I had this issue once too. I think TT is correct about the ringing voltage. It sounds crazy, but we plugged a splitter into the wall where the fax connected and had a traditional 2500 (double gong metal ringer) set plugged in with the fax. The load of the ringer on this phone seemed to alter or drag the ringing voltage enough that their fax would answer. If we unplugged the phone, the fax didn't answer. We ended up putting the phone back in the equipment room on the same extension number and turned down the ringer as low as we could. It may or may not work.
